00:00
接下来我们再给集群里边安装上一个K8S的可视化界面,大家会看到啊,我们现在如果在这儿一直操作命令行的话,这对初学者貌似有点不太友好啊,所以呢,我们可以安装一个K8S官方提供的一个web的可视化界面,我们在界面上点点点啊,来操作K8S的一些东西,那这个界面呢,官方马它叫单是bird k8S的单是bird,这是官方K8S可视化界面的get have地址,大家可以看一看,如果我们想要部署这个呢,其实非常方便,一句话就完了啊,Controller play,杠F,你就把我这行代码一复制,你就会能看到杠F,我们之前说过,我们给K8S里边创建一些资源啥的,你只要有资源的配置文件,只需要使用这个命令,这个配置文件呢,当然也可以是远程的,这是我们K8S单是bird的配置文件,好把这个文件呢复制过来,让K8S呢,按照这个单是bird的配置文件。
01:00
把单式的资源给创建到我们K板集群里边,稍等好我直接回车,这是我们的第一步,我们先把这个灯是bird k8S的,这是什么可视化界面,对吧?我先安装上稍等啊,这得等一会儿,因为他要先联网下载这个下载完了以后呢,才会给你把这些资源配置文件里边指定的资源给我们整过来,来看一下进度怎样,这等了一阵呢,还没等来你就可以把这个中断了,因为这个资源呢,是从get这引用的,有可能下载不来,所以你可以手动先把这个资源下载来,也是一样的啊,这个远程的有点不好看,好我先呢把这个资源下载来,使用w get命令回车,W get还没装,那就亚M英ste w get这个工具先一装好,然后呢我们再来使用这个。
02:00
明明先把这个资源下载来,嗯,看着这还挺慢,一次不行就再来一次,这这还不行,那大家稍等啊,我这个链接复制一下,因为我这个电脑浏览器可以科学上网,我就把这个内容呢,直接拿来看一下能不能拿到,好,这是这个文件的所有内容,如果大家也搞不定的话,就直接复制我文件的内容,呃,我们来安装这个控制面板,就是以上文件找不到,那就用我的这个啊,这是一个压面文件,我直接CTRLV1粘,你有了这个文件以后咋办呢?那就来到这儿,可以VI,我们就叫单式bird的点样面,K8S的单式bird,你把那堆东西一粘贴就行了,WQ退出并保存库班control出了。
03:00
只要有了资源的配置文件,Apply-F单式bird回车好这一块呢,它就开始创建了,至此呢,而且你可以等一下啊,后边controltr get pod-A就是呢,很多配置文件呢,一定会产生运行中的应用,比如你看K8S的这个dashboard控制这个控制台,它呢应用就开始创建了,就等这个应用的控制台创建完,K8S的这个控制台只要创建完那就没问题,大家就复制我这个就行了啊这个里边呢,主要你看它这大概的像这个配置文件,大家可能现在看不懂,但大概的看两下你能知道,诶,这突然指定了一个image这个镜像,这看来看去这都像我们docker的镜像,对吧?所以呢,K8S整个呢,就是管理容器的,它也你想让它启动应用,它也得用这个镜像来启动,所以我们先整到这儿啊,那K8S的我们的这个,我们就等它启动我们看一下。
04:00
这个的有没有,我们再来等下面啊,一定要等两个的都,K8S的这个控制面板就准备好了,好两个都running那没问题,但K8S的控制面板呢,准备好了以后,你想在我们的这个浏览器通过我们这个公网IP访问,你还得稍微做一些设置,这个设置呢,将来大家就跟着我做,先别先别想为啥你先跟着我做,做完了我们学到后边你才会为啥先运行第一行命令,把这个复制来,所有命令都要在master节点来粘贴,这叫相当于我们去来修改集群中的某个资源,剩下的先不用管,然后呢,在这敲斜线,找到这个叫type冒号回车,好,你就会呢,找到一个叫type克class IP。
05:00
你输入I进入插入模式,把它呢变成no port,先不要问为啥先给我变WQ退出并保存好这块呢,变完了以后呢,接下来这是你做的第一步,第一步啊,变完了以后呢,将第二步运行我的这个命令,刚才的那一句话,相当于把K8S的这个web访问界面的端口给暴露到我们的机器上,这样呢,我们就就跟刀口杠P端口映射一样,暴露出来以后呢,接下来我们就能呃在服务器上按照端口访问了回车,然你就会看到啊,你运行我这个命令回车了以后,将来你就会在这儿看到这么一个东西叫30753,就是一个3万多的端口,这个端口就是我们未来访问K8S控制台的好。
06:00
我把这个已复制,然后呢,因为你想要访问这个端口,就得在我们的这个云服务器的安全组里边,你得开放这个端口,我们现在是默认安全组点进来,那我们就把这个端口一开放啊,这个端口我点一个添加规则,这个K8S,比如我名字就叫K8S,但是bird的端口就是这个,就是这个,你的是什么,你就在这儿填什么,我点一个确定,点一个应用修改,然后呢,只要你添了这个端口,那接下来接下来啊,K8S集群里边呢,最帅的就是将来你只要使用K8S集群里边任意一台机器的公网IP加上这个端口就能访问到了啊,所以呢,那我就任意拿一个吧,比如拿这个K8S note2也行,把NOTE2的这个节点的IP我复制来CTRLC啊,然后呢,加上我们指定的。
07:00
端口它冒号我们的这个端口是多少来着,看一下叫这叫30753,那就3075,诶30753回车访问这个就行了啊,它这一块一直在转啊,那是访问错了,我们这个控制台呢,是HTTPS的方式,安全连接的方式,回车好一定使用HTPS,所以呢,最后就是集群HTPS加集群任意端口,我们这个安全组放行了,没应用修改30753是不是这个端口来确认一下啊,3073好,就是这个没问题,然后那么在这儿安全组已经放行了上海一区的30753。
08:00
呃,我们来看一下啊,实际我们的安全组应该是哪个呢?我们的这个KYS集群的VPC网络是确认安全组啊,然后呢,包括我们来看我们每每一台机器他们的安全组规则是哪一个绑定资源安全组策略,对安全组策略呢,它跟着,诶你看啊,每一台机器的安全组又不一样,所以这一块就神奇了,那我们接下来呢,就来做一件事,把我们VPC网络的安全组,因为我们每一个机器使用这个自定义安全组了,我们VPC网络也设置这个安安全组呢,一个一设置,那就大家都设置了,好稍等啊,这个改变我们提交一下,好更新我们用自定义的安全组,然后我们设置自定义的安全组,相当于我们服我们机器的防火墙,跟这个VPC的防火墙是一样的啊,要不然你每次你得设两三个好。
09:00
我们呢,就是这个三零,这个叫30753,所以一般你确定你的资源开通没问题,还是访问不到,就先优先找你的安全组,18S默认的那个安全组就有问题,提交点应用修改30753啊稍等一下,好,这个规则运用好了以后呢,我们直接回车,诶大家只要看到这个界面就行了,说你的连接不是私密连接,点个高级继续前往就行了,那我们至此就来到了K8S的登录界面,那这个登录界面呢,要求你在这儿填一个令牌,这个令牌从哪来?接下来大家又运行我下边的命令,在这呢,又准备一个K8S的,相当于访问的,相当于给K8S创建一个访问者身份啊,还是一样VI叫,但使user准备一个文件啊。
10:00
User店压面,然后把我的内容直接给这一粘,也甭管上一粘,WQ退出并保存,然后库包ctrler a play应用一下,我们说只要K8S集群里边有一种资源的配置文件,我们只要一应用就好了,你看那集群里边有一个din user已经被创建了啊,Adin user,我们一个服务账号叫adin user,相当于有一个用户叫adin user,那这个用户呢,不是拿用户名密码登的,是拿我们成为令牌,这个令牌呢,大家又拿我这句话来获取一下就行了,大家大家先别关心这些话是什么意思,你学完K8S你回过头再来看才知道啥意思,好,我就直接来回车啊,大致意思就是去K8S获取一下K8S,但是bird的这个密密钥对吧,就是这个东西回车好,然后呢,接下来他会给你给这么一串令牌,把这一串令牌从头复制到尾。
11:00
就是这个啊,你可以诶呃复制到这,看到这个,注意是这个route mask,这个中括号结束,大家别忘了啊,这从这开始,中括号结束,把这个一复制,从这个回车换行开始到最后,最后这个左中括号结束,你可以把这个呢,提前保存到你这儿啊大家其实有些同学一看这个格式,像什么什么GWT头玩意儿的,对吧?然后你把这个一拿来,只要有这个玩意,CTRLV1粘贴已登录好这个就OK了啊所以呢,至此我们就看到了K8S的控制台,控制台里边呢,这一块能切换我们成为名称空间,后来我们会说什么叫名称空间,你随便点一个,哎,整到一个名称空间,你就能看K8S里边的各种资源,资源里边,我们之前说了一个K8S正在运行的应用,我们把它称为什么?什么叫pod,点进来看,这不就是正在运行中的应用,这都是。
12:00
系统底层的应用,我们先不用管是什么,好,那我们整个K8S的这个控制台也登进来了啊。
我来说两句